Cramerton board approves contractor for downtown stormwater, parking and event-space project
Summary
The Town of Cramerton Board of Commissioners on March 23 approved contracting authority to finalize a construction agreement for the Downtown Stormwater/Parking/Event Space capital project and set a spring start date; the bid record shows Draw Enterprises as the lowest bidder but staff said it could not be certified.
The Town of Cramerton Board of Commissioners voted 5-0 on March 23 to direct town counsel, the town manager and the project engineers to finalize a construction contract for the Downtown Stormwater/Parking/Event Space capital project.
Engineer Danny Watkins of LaBella presented the board with three responsive bids: Draw Enterprises, Inc., $598,615.50; Site Services of the Carolinas, LLC, $785,968.05; and Showalter Construction Company, Inc., $975,791.25.
